Address

DMLfmdu5BMPymE88f3beyjQWtVkcLe2a4t

0 DGB

Confirmed
Total Received 38.97610600 DGB0.33 USD
Total Sent 38.97610600 DGB0.33 USD
Final Balance 0 DGB0.00 USD
No. Transactions 2

Transactions

DMLfmdu5BMPymE88f3beyjQWtVkcLe2a4t 38.97610600 DGB1.69 USD0.33 USD
 
DGraQNXUUtp7koHfEVd3KCqd22hMmpTgpW 38.97580000 DGB1.69 USD0.33 USD
D7mWQhQzGe9nTLncvcMFrsA16DULXeH3U5 0.00008000 DGB0.00 USD0.00 USD
DEfUHrWGSrgQkzq8xfpWG61AyuQWa4SXnP 38.97641200 DGB1.69 USD0.33 USD
 
DAWY2o7YwLU6nUZQhJLUraSvjE9HG5148u 0.00008000 DGB0.00 USD0.00 USD
DMLfmdu5BMPymE88f3beyjQWtVkcLe2a4t 38.97610600 DGB1.69 USD0.33 USD